Fished a private pond this morning with a fellow HOW volunteer and my son. My son missed a few but caught a couple on this slow and hot day. My buddy missed several bass blow ups on his hollow bodies frog. I on the other hand had a decent day. Managed seven total on the day, the most memorable being my first ever citation fish out of the kayak. This big girl breached the pads like Air Jaws and was an absolute fatty! She nailed my Clone Frog with a purpose! She measured out at 22.75". An awesome day!

Nice fish. Why not send in both sets of paperwork? The VA Citation has no time limit. The other is still valid if you decide to send it in.

  • Author

The scale wasn't certified, and I'm not killing a fish on the chance it may be a weight citation. I practice C.P.R. In fresh water. That's Catch, Photo, Release so that someone else might experience the same feelings I did.
